Project Abstract

The effects of climate change on agriculture and forestry have become increasingly apparent in recent years, posing significant challenges to food security and environmental sustainability. This research project aims to analyze the impact of climate change on crop yield in agriculture and forestry, focusing on understanding the key factors influencing crop productivity under changing climatic conditions. The study will employ a combination of quantitative analysis, field observations, and modeling techniques to assess the relationship between climate variables and crop yield outcomes. Chapter 1 provides an introduction to the research topic, highlighting the background of the study, problem statement, objectives, limitations, scope, significance, structure, and definitions of key terms. The chapter sets the context for the research and outlines the key questions that will be addressed in the study. Chapter 2 presents a comprehensive literature review, covering ten key areas related to climate change impacts on crop yield in agriculture and forestry. The review synthesizes existing knowledge and identifies gaps in the current understanding of the subject, providing a theoretical framework for the research. Chapter 3 outlines the research methodology, detailing the approach, design, data collection methods, sampling techniques, variables, and analytical tools that will be used in the study. This chapter describes how the research will be conducted to achieve the research objectives effectively and efficiently. Chapter 4 discusses the findings of the research, presenting a detailed analysis of the impact of climate change on crop yield based on the data collected and analyzed. The chapter examines the relationships between climate variables and crop productivity, identifying patterns, trends, and potential implications for agricultural and forestry practices. Chapter 5 concludes the research project, summarizing the key findings, implications, and recommendations based on the analysis of climate change impacts on crop yield in agriculture and forestry. The chapter reflects on the research outcomes, discusses the significance of the results, and suggests potential avenues for future research in the field. Overall, this research project aims to contribute to the understanding of how climate change is affecting crop yield in agriculture and forestry, providing valuable insights for policymakers, researchers, and practitioners working in the field of sustainable agriculture and environmental management. The study seeks to inform evidence-based decision-making and promote strategies for adapting to and mitigating the impacts of climate change on crop productivity and food security.
